mass-assignment

    16

    3答えて

    大量割り当てがどのようなものであり、どのようにコードするのかを明確にしたいだけです。 質量割り当てハッシュを使用して多くの分野の割り当て、すなわちなどの... @user = User.new(params[:user]) そして、あなたはattr_accessible使用し、これを阻止することであるように: attr_accessible :name, :email だから、そのようなフ

    3

    4答えて

    Railsでattr_accessibleを使用することについて質問があります。 質量割り当ての保護を回避するために、guard_protected_attributesからfalseに設定することがあります。 @user.attributes=({ :name => "James Bond", :admin => true }, false) ...しかし、このことを行います:次の行が動作し

    6

    4答えて

    モデルでattr_accessibleを使用して、質量割り当ての問題を解決したかったのです。私はそれがどのように機能し、できる限り研究したのか理解しています。 update_attributes(params [:my_form])またはcreate(params [:my_form])を使用してフィールドを1つずつ設定することの違いはわかりません。両方とも脆弱ではない? attr_accessi

    2

    1答えて

    ちょっと、 Railsのnoobですが、これは私を困惑させました。 Withは、Railsに多数の関連付けをしています。私がワインバーにワインリストを付けるときには、このようなものでワインリスト協会(またはを通して)のテーブルを使ってワインを割り当てます。 class WineBarController def update @winebar = WineBar.find(

    1

    1答えて

    私は、ユーザーがエントリに投票できるようにするためにこれを使用する: <% form_tag url_for(entry_votes_path(@entry)), :id => 'voting_form', :remote => true do %> <%= hidden_field_tag 'vote[user_id]', current_user.id %> <%= s